1. What is AJAX?

AJAX is a technique used in web development to update parts of a web page without reloading the entire page. It combines multiple technologies including JavaScript, XML, HTML, and CSS to create a seamless user experience.

2. How does AJAX work?

Traditionally, when a user interacts with a web page, a request is sent to the server, and the server sends back a response that is rendered on the web page. With AJAX, instead of reloading the entire page, only the necessary data is fetched from the server and dynamically inserted into the page.

AJAX uses XMLHTTPRequest or fetch API to send asynchronous HTTP requests to the server. The server responds with the necessary data, which is then rendered on the website using JavaScript. This allows for seamless interactions without causing a page refresh.

3. Benefits of Using AJAX on a Website

By using AJAX on your website, you can provide a better user experience with faster, more responsive interactions. Here are some key benefits of using AJAX:

– Enhanced User Experience: AJAX allows you to update specific parts of a web page without reloading the entire page. This provides a smoother and more interactive experience for your users.

– Faster Loading Times: With AJAX, you can fetch only the necessary data from the server instead of reloading the entire page. This reduces the amount of data transferred and speeds up loading times.

– Reduced Server Load: AJAX allows you to offload some processing tasks to the client-side, reducing the load on your server. This can improve scalability and handle more concurrent users.

– Improved Interactivity: AJAX enables real-time data updates on your website, making it ideal for chat applications, live search, and other interactive features.

4. AJAX and Website Speed

AJAX plays a crucial role in boosting website speed. By fetching data asynchronously and dynamically updating the web page, AJAX reduces the need for full page reloads. This results in faster loading times and a more responsive website.

When a user interacts with an AJAX-powered website, only the necessary data is transmitted between the server and the client. This significantly reduces the amount of data transferred, leading to faster response times. As a result, users can enjoy a seamless experience with minimal waiting times.

5. AJAX Performance Optimization Techniques

While AJAX can greatly enhance website speed, it’s important to optimize its performance further for the best results. Here are some key techniques to consider:

– Reduce HTTP Requests: Minimize the number of HTTP requests made by combining multiple JavaScript and CSS files. This reduces the overhead of establishing a new connection each time a file is requested.

– Minify and Combine JavaScript and CSS Files: Minify your JavaScript and CSS files by removing unnecessary characters and comments. Additionally, combine them into a single file to reduce the number of requests.

– Use Caching: Utilize browser caching to store static resources such as images, JavaScript, and CSS files. This allows browsers to load resources from the cache rather than fetching them from the server, resulting in faster loading times.

– Optimize Images: Compress and resize images to reduce their file size. Large images can significantly slow down a website, so using optimized images is crucial for performance.

– Implement Gzip Compression: Enable Gzip compression on your server to compress files before sending them to the client. This reduces file sizes and speeds up data transfer.

– Leverage Browser Caching: Set appropriate cache-control headers to leverage browser caching. This allows the browser to store resources locally and retrieve them from the cache instead of making a server request.

6. Balancing AJAX and SEO

While AJAX can greatly improve website speed and user experience, it’s important to consider the impact it may have on search engine optimization (SEO). Search engines traditionally struggled to crawl and index AJAX-powered websites due to the absence of static URLs and content.

However, with advancements in technology, search engines have become better at understanding and indexing AJAX-driven content. It’s essential to follow SEO best practices such as providing crawlable URLs, making content accessible without JavaScript, and implementing proper metadata.

By balancing AJAX and SEO, you can have a fast and user-friendly website that also performs well in search engine rankings.

7. FAQs

Q1. Can AJAX be used for all types of websites?
A1. Yes, AJAX can be used in almost any type of website. However, it’s important to carefully consider the use cases and the impact on SEO.

Q2. Can using AJAX slow down a website?
A2. AJAX itself doesn’t slow down a website. However, improper implementation or excessive use of AJAX can negatively impact performance. It’s crucial to optimize AJAX requests and use performance optimization techniques mentioned earlier.

Q3. Is AJAX compatible with all browsers?
A3. AJAX is supported by all modern browsers. However, older versions of Internet Explorer may have limited support or require workarounds.

Q4. How can AJAX be used in e-commerce websites?
A4. AJAX can enhance various aspects of e-commerce websites, including live search, dynamic cart updates, and real-time inventory management.

Q5. Are there any security concerns with AJAX?
A5. AJAX introduces new security considerations, such as cross-site scripting (XSS) and cross-site request forgery (CSRF). It’s important to implement proper security measures, such as input validation and using secure connections.
